What is a Bioness?

A Bioness job typically refers to a position within Bioness, a company that develops neuromodulation and rehabilitation technologies to help individuals recover mobility and function. Roles at Bioness may include positions in engineering, research, sales, or clinical support, focusing on medical devices that assist patients with neurological conditions or injuries. Employees often work with healthcare providers and patients to implement Bioness products for improved rehabilitation outcomes.

What does a Bioness clinical or field specialist do?

Individuals working in clinical or field specialist roles at Bioness are typically responsible for supporting clinicians and patients in the setup, training, and troubleshooting of Bioness devices. This often involves traveling to healthcare facilities, conducting product demonstrations, responding to technical inquiries, and providing ongoing clinical education to both staff and patients. Collaboration with sales, engineering, and rehabilitation teams is frequent to ensure a seamless user experience and continuous product improvement. This role offers hands-on patient interaction, real-world application of the latest neurorehabilitation technology, and opportunities for professional growth as new devices and markets are developed.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in a Bioness position?

Bioness is a company known for neuromodulation medical devices, with roles typically requiring a background in biomedical engineering, physical therapy, or similar health sciences, as well as experience with neurorehabilitation technologies. Expertise in using and troubleshooting medical devices, along with familiarity with healthcare compliance standards and certifications such as physical therapist licensure or engineering credentials, is often necessary. Strong communication, patient education abilities, and collaborative skills are highly valued in this position. These competencies are essential for delivering optimal patient outcomes, ensuring device efficacy, and supporting successful integration with medical teams.
